I Love You

“Double Portrait” and “I Love You” are a paired piece with Akiko Iimura. Both Iimuras play individually as well as a unit. In “Double Portrait” they are never together, but one by one in three points of view, front, side, and back, assigned to the words “I”, “You” and “He/She” respectively. The pronouns rotate with every repetition, for instance, in front view with “You”, then “He/She” and back to “I”. Often the words are destroyed acoustically making them unintelligible. “I Love You” is not a style of confession, but the words, and a linguistic practice using a sentence and shifting the pronouns.

Dokudami Tenement

Yoshio is a 24-year-old man born in Saidaiji , Okayama prefecture. He moved to Tokyo, bringing his guitar, in search of the bohemian lifestyle, and settled in Asagaya, West Tokyo. Within one year he has sold his guitar and has become a day labourer on civll construction projects.With no guarantee of constant work the only accommodation available to him is the cheapest type of accommodation, that with no bathroom, no air-conditioning, no bath, a shared toilet, a shared kitchen "Dokudami-so" with "no money, no job, no woman.

Kinnikuman: The Stolen Championship Belt

The first theatrical film of the anime series Kinnikuman. After winning the 21st Choujin Olympics, Kinnikuman plans to build his own theme park. As his friends and celebrities arrive, the sky grows dark and with a flash of lightning Kinnikuman's championship belt is gone. He then sees that it has been taken by Octopus Dragon III, who challenges him to take it back. Kinnikuman tries but fails and Mari is kidnapped. Octopus Dragon gives Kinnikuman a time limit to save her before she is fed to the monster Gigasaurus and then returns to his home world of Planet Metro (メトロ星, Metoro-sei). Despite his injuries, Kinnikuman is determined to go and reclaim his belt and Mari. Luckily, Terryman, Ramenman, Robin Mask, Warsman, Brocken Jr., and Rikishiman arrive to lend him a hand.
